深入了解Wireshark:网络数据包分析利器 / 深入了解Wireshark:网络数据包分析利器

Wireshark是一款广泛使用的网络协议分析工具,它能够抓取并分析网络数据包,帮助用户深入了解网络中的通信过程,从而有效地诊断网络故障和优化网络性能。本文将介绍Wireshark的基本原理和使用方法,并探讨它在网络管理和安全方面的应用。

Wireshark基本原理

Wireshark的原理是通过网络适配器捕获网络上的数据包,并对这些数据包进行解码和分析。当数据包在网络上传输时,它们会被打上各种标记和头部信息,这些信息包含了数据包的源地址、目的地址、协议类型、数据长度等等。Wireshark可以根据这些信息对数据包进行分类和解码,从而帮助用户了解数据包的内容和意义。

Wireshark使用方法

使用Wireshark进行数据包分析的基本步骤如下:

1.选择网络适配器

打开Wireshark后,需要选择一个网络适配器进行数据包捕获。通常情况下,用户可以选择自己的网卡作为网络适配器,也可以选择虚拟网卡等其他适配器。

2.开始抓包

选择完网络适配器后,点击“开始抓包”按钮即可开始抓取数据包。在抓取过程中,Wireshark会实时显示捕获到的数据包,并对其进行解码和分析。

3.分析数据包

抓取完数据包后,用户可以对数据包进行深入分析。Wireshark提供了各种功能,如过滤器、统计功能等,帮助用户分析数据包的内容和结构。

Wireshark在网络管理和安全方面的应用

Wireshark在网络管理和安全方面有着广泛的应用。下面分别介绍一下它们的具体应用。

1.网络管理

在网络管理中,Wireshark可以帮助用户实时监测网络流量,发现网络瓶颈和故障,并优化网络性能。例如,用户可以使用Wireshark分析TCP/IP协议栈的运行情况,查找网络拥塞和延迟等问题。

2.网络安全

在网络安全方面,Wireshark可以帮助用户监测网络中的恶意流量,发现网络攻击和漏洞,并采取相应的防御措施。例如,用户可以使用Wireshark分析网络流量,查找是否存在DOS攻击、DDOS攻击等网络安全问题。

Android操作系统是目前全球使用最广泛的移动操作系统之一。它由谷歌公司开发,用于智能手机、平板电脑和其他移动设备。Android操作系统采用开源的方式发布,这意味着任何人都可以免费获得和使用它。由于其普及和灵活性,Android已经成为移动设备市场的主导者。

Android的核心是Linux内核。它包含了操作系统的所有基本功能,例如内存管理、硬件驱动程序和安全性等。谷歌还开发了许多高级功能和应用程序,如Google Play商店、Google Maps、Google Drive和Google Chrome等。这些应用程序可以轻松下载和使用,让用户能够尽情探索和享受移动互联网的便利。

Android操作系统的一个重要特点是其开放性。任何开发者都可以使用Android的开发工具包(SDK)开发应用程序,这让Android应用程序的数量达到了数百万个。Android开发生态系统非常庞大,开发者可以根据自己的需要定制操作系统,并将自己的应用程序发布到Google Play商店,从而获得更广泛的用户群。

另一个值得注意的特点是Android的多样性。由于Android开放的特性,许多手机厂商和设备制造商都可以根据自己的需要和风格自定义操作系统。这意味着用户可以根据自己的品味和需求选择不同的品牌和型号的Android设备,同时拥有相似的基础功能和应用程序。

总之,Android操作系统已成为移动设备市场的领导者,其普及性、开放性和多样性为用户带来了便利和选择。作为移动时代的代表,Android在智能手机、平板电脑和其他移动设备中扮演着越来越重要的角色。

文章完。